Firefighters Leave Scene Of Cairngorms Wildfire After Nearly Five Weeks

Firefighters leave scene of Cairngorms wildfire after nearly five weeks Firefighters have completed work to tackle the Cairngorms wildfire nearly five weeks after it began. The Scottish Fire and Rescue Service (SFRS) said crews left the scene on Monday and handed the final affected area around the RSPB Abernethy Nature Reserve over to the RSPB.

Closed Doors And Dead Ends In Support For Violence Fixated Young People

‘Closed doors and dead ends’ in support for violence-fixated young people The Children’s Commissioner has warned of “closed doors and dead ends” for many education providers when they refer young people to the Government’s anti-terror programme. Referrals to Prevent involving children have risen in the past decade, from 2,918 in 2016-17 to 4,715 in 2024-25.
